Lines Matching refs:subfile
185 enter_line_range (struct subfile *, unsigned, unsigned,
474 struct subfile *subfile;
564 /* subfile structure for the main compilation unit. */
565 struct subfile main_subfile;
599 struct subfile *tmpSubfile;
609 /* Have a new subfile for the include file. */
611 tmpSubfile = inclTable[ii].subfile =
612 (struct subfile *) xmalloc (sizeof (struct subfile));
614 memset (tmpSubfile, '\0', sizeof (struct subfile));
665 if ((inclTable[ii].subfile)->line_vector) /* Useless if!!! FIXMEmgo */
669 lv = (inclTable[ii].subfile)->line_vector;
679 subfile. This happens if we have something like:
733 /* Start with a fresh subfile structure for the next file. */
734 memset (&main_subfile, '\0', sizeof (struct subfile));
747 enter_line_range (subfile, beginoffset, endoffset, startaddr, 0, firstLine) or
748 enter_line_range (subfile, beginoffset, 0, startaddr, endaddr, firstLine)
754 enter_line_range (struct subfile *subfile, unsigned beginoffset, unsigned endoffset, /* offsets to line table */
809 record_line (subfile, 0, addr);
813 record_line (subfile, *firstLine + int_lnno.l_lnno, addr);